The thirteen books "Elements" were written or collected by Euclid of Alexandria about 300 BCE.

Many think that "Elements" is the most important example of deductive mathematics.

In fact, the Common Notions and the Postulates of Elements are not just arbitrary axioms. 

They should be regarded as marvelous pearls in the ocean of geometry.  

Discovering and proving theorems are the Arts of Mathematics.
